Oia Desalination Plant

On Santorini (Thira) Island, Greece, a seawater reverse osmosis desalination plant was installed to produce potable water for the Thira Water & Sewage Authority. With a total capacity of 2,500 m³/day, the facility provides a reliable water supply solution for the island, supporting local needs under demanding operating conditions. Completed in 2023, the project contributes to strengthening Santorini’s potable water infrastructure through efficient and proven SW-RO desalination technology.
